What happens when someone promotes themselves to Walmart management and gives themselves free groceries for five months? Andy and Greg begin this episode with a ridiculous news story that somehow feels completely believable.
Then the conversation heads back to St. Louis, where a simple dinner with a longtime friend turns into an unforgettable comedy of errors. A missing cutting board. A chef’s knife hidden beneath appliance manuals. A house without a bowl big enough for a cantaloupe. And a lesson in why some people should never be left in charge of the kitchen.
Along the way, the guys talk about:
- A fake Walmart executive who almost pulled off the perfect scam
- The strange psychology of clipboards and confidence
- Cardinals baseball, stadium entertainment, and T-shirt cannons
- Jimmy John’s vs. Wendy’s chili
- Imo’s Pizza and St. Louis-style pizza
- Aging, friendship, caregiving, and the unexpected humor hiding in ordinary moments
